Does Skoda Fabia have power steering?

The Skoda Fabia uses a modern electronic power steering system which consists of an Electronic Power Steering Pump, a hydraulic Power Steering Rack and high pressure & low pressure hydraulic pipes which connect them together.

What does a power steering sensor do?

Your car’s power steering pressure switch monitors the amount of pressure in the system, and communicates that information to the car’s computer. If it notices a drop in pressure, the car’s computer may turn on a warning light in the dash.

What goes wrong with Skoda Fabia?

What are the most common problems with a used Skoda Fabia hatchback? Excessive oil consumption has been reported, as have electrical glitches, fuel pumps issues and water leaking into the car.

What happens when a power steering pressure sensor goes bad?

Engine slowing down As soon as the power steering pressure switch starts to go bad, the computer will not be able to keep up with the demand of the power steering system and make proper adjustments. One symptom of this is the engine will slow down when you turn a corner, or while you are driving at low speeds.

Where is the power steering pressure sensor located?

The power steering pressure switch is located either at the power steering pump or the gearbox.
